How to Stay Safe Online
Here are 10 basic security tips to help you avoid malware and protect your devices.
Use a good antivirus and keep it up-to-date
It's essential to use a quality antivirus to stay ahead of cyber threats. Free solutions are available for all devices that protect against malware and viruses.
Keep software and operating systems up-to-date
Software companies regularly update platforms to fix vulnerabilities. Update your operating system, browsers, and apps whenever prompted.
Be careful when installing programs and apps
Pay close attention to installation options and uncheck agreements for toolbars and add-ons. Take care in every stage of the process.
Install an ad blocker
Advertisements can sometimes spread malware. Use ad blockers that stop malicious ads, images, and other content that antivirus might miss.
Be careful what you download
Research before downloading freeware or apps that might carry hidden malware. Be especially cautious with torrent files.
Be alert for people trying to trick you
Stay vigilant against phishing and social engineering. Remembxer that banks never ask for passwords, and familiar names don't make messages trustworthy.
Back up your data
Backup frequently and verify that backups can be restored. Use external drives disconnected from your computer or trusted cloud services.
Choose strong passwords
Use unique passwords for all accounts. Avoid personal information and enable two-factor authentication (2FA) when possible.
Be careful where you click
Exercise caution with links or attachments from unknown sources. These could contain malware or phishing scams.
Don't use pirated software
Avoid key generators, file sharing programs, and cracked software. These are often compromised with malware or crypto-miners.
